Overview
Look-up Tables allow Centres to customise categories, statuses, and reference values used throughout Onefile. These custom values influence features such as Registers, Episodes, Notes, Timesheets, Delivery Plans, Reviews, and more.
Permissions
Who Can Use This Feature?
This feature can be used by the following user role:
- Centre Manager
Steps
- Click Centre on the left-hand navigation bar.
- Click Look-up Tables.
- Select the Look-up Table you wish to create.
- Click Create.
- Add a Name for the Look-up value.
- Click Save.
Tips & Notes
- Look-up Tables allow Centres to customise dropdown values used across Onefile ePortfolio.
- Changes apply instantly once saved.
- Only Centre Managers can add or edit Look-up Tables.
Where Are Look-up Tables Used?
| Look-up Table | Where They Are Used / What They Control |
|---|---|
| Absence Codes | Used within the Registers feature. Determines the list of available absence reasons when marking a learner absent. |
| Anticipated Completion Date Change Reason | Allows Centres to define reasons for updating a learner’s anticipated completion date. |
| Additional Courses | Records courses completed outside the learner’s main framework. Managed via the Episode tab. |
| Learner Status | Defines a learner’s current status. Visible on the learner portfolio, used as a reporting filter, and available in Plans, Reviews and the Episode tab. |
| Learning Aim Status | Custom statuses for individual learning aims. The system includes default options such as Failed and Withdrawn. |
| Placement Document Categories | Categories for documents uploaded to placements, supporting filtering and organisation. |
| Providers | Allows Centre Managers to create and assign Providers to learners. |
| Timesheet Categories | Groups timesheet entries for reporting. If marked as Learning Activity, they appear when adding entries to the Learning Journal. |
| Delivery Plans | Used to create categories, delivery leads, funding sources, and methods used in Delivery Plan templates. |
| Note Categories | Allows Centres to categorise notes, improving filtering and searching. |
| Journal Fields | Allows Centres to create custom fields which appear when learners or staff create Learning Journal entries. |
| Review Types | Defines the types of Progress Reviews available in the system (e.g., 12‑week review, formal review). |
